Visa Requirements for International Visitors
International visitors are required to obtain a Temporary Activity visa (subclass 408) to participate in the Visiting Scholar Program. Please be aware that current processing times can be up to five months or longer, so early planning is essential. All international visits should therefore be planned at least 12 months in advance.
A Visitor visa (subclass 600) or eVisitor (subclass 651) is not suitable for participation in this program.
Visits of up to 3 months
For visits of three months or less, visiting scholars are responsible for securing a visa that permits all planned program activities while in Australia. Processing times can vary and may take several months, so applicants should submit their Visiting Scholar application as early as possible.
Visits longer than 3 months
For visits exceeding three months, the visa application process will be managed through Visa Lawyers Australia (VLA), who will advise on the appropriate visa type. All visa application charges and VLA fees must be covered by the applicant, unless compelling reasons for an exemption are provided. Such requests will be assessed on a case-by-case basis.
